Federal Statistics, Multiple Data Sources, and Privacy Protection: Next Steps

Federal Statistics, Multiple Data Sources, and Privacy Protection: Next Steps by Engineering, and Medicine National Academies of Sciences
English | Jan. 10, 2018 | ASIN: B078XKSDMR | 194 Pages | PDF | 1 MB

The environment for obtaining information and providing statistical data for policy makers and the public has changed significantly in the past decade, raising questions about the fundamental survey paradigm that underlies federal statistics. New data sources provide opportunities to develop a new paradigm that can improve timeliness, geographic or subpopulation detail, and statistical efficiency. It also has the potential to reduce the costs of producing federal statistics.
